HOME
NEWS
INTERVIEWS
OPINION
EDITORIAL FEATURES
GAME CHANGERS
ARCHIVE
Tag: Robots
Results 1 - 3 of 3
Robots
Monday, 22 May 2023
Robots
|
Middle East
Monday, 22 May 2023
Dubai
|
Robots
|
food
Saturday, 18 February 2023